What are the primary purposes of a grounded neutral conductor in a grounded service?

The primary purposes of a grounded neutral conductor in a grounded service are indeed to carry maximum unbalanced return neutral load and to serve as an effective ground-fault current path.

The grounded neutral conductor is essential in the functioning of an electrical system, as it ensures that any unbalanced load between the phase conductors can safely return through the neutral wire. This capability is particularly crucial in typical residential wiring, where appliances and devices may not draw equal power, leading to an unbalanced load scenario.

Additionally, the grounded neutral provides a safe path for fault currents, which is vital for protecting electrical systems from faults such as short circuits. In the event of a ground fault, the neutral conductor allows the fault current to return to the source and facilitate tripping the circuit protection devices, such as circuit breakers. This action greatly enhances safety by reducing the risk of electric shock or fire hazards.

Understanding these functions highlights the importance of a properly grounded neutral in maintaining safe and efficient electrical operations.
